1982 Nissan Prairie vs. 1994 Rover 200

To start off, 1994 Rover 200 is newer by 12 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1982 Nissan Prairie.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1982 Nissan Prairie would be higher. At 1,809 cc (4 cylinders), 1982 Nissan Prairie is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1994 Rover 200 (102 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 13 more horse power than 1982 Nissan Prairie. (89 HP @ 5200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1994 Rover 200 should accelerate faster than 1982 Nissan Prairie.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1994 Rover 200 weights approximately 15 kg more than 1982 Nissan Prairie.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1982 Nissan Prairie (150 Nm @ 3700 RPM) has 22 more torque (in Nm) than 1994 Rover 200. (128 Nm @ 5000 RPM). This means 1982 Nissan Prairie will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1994 Rover 200.

Compare all specifications:

1982 Nissan Prairie 1994 Rover 200
Make Nissan Rover
Model Prairie 200
Year Released 1982 1994
Engine Size 1809 cc 1396 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 89 HP 102 HP
Engine RPM 5200 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 150 Nm 128 Nm
Torque RPM 3700 RPM 5000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Front Front
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Vehicle Weight 1060 kg 1075 kg
Vehicle Length 4100 mm 4230 mm
Vehicle Width 1670 mm 1690 mm
Vehicle Height 1610 mm 1410 mm
Wheelbase Size 2520 mm 2510 mm
